I am not sure that everything that is requested gets implemented.
There is no documentation mention of support or not. It would be good to have some statement in documentation about support or lack of support or limitations, a documentation enhancement would make sense.
Note that while this does seem to work, it also prevents you from doing cross platform restore or restore to a volume, that does not support encryption. You will get restore error (Cannot create), clarifying that specified file is encrypted.